Your role as a Trainee Estate Agent / Trainee Sales Negotiator
The main purpose of the role is to generate and book valuations, conduct property viewings, negotiate offers, agree sales and progress sales through to exchange and completion. You will also be optimising every opportunity to schedule appointments for the branch Mortgage Advisor.

How to prepare for a job interview at Bridgfords
✨Show Your Sales Skills
As a Trainee Estate Agent, demonstrating your sales experience is crucial. Prepare examples of how you've successfully generated new business or closed deals in the past. This will show your potential employer that you have the right mindset for a target-driven environment.
✨Highlight Customer Service Experience
Outstanding customer care is key in this role. Be ready to discuss specific instances where you've gone above and beyond for customers. This will illustrate your commitment to providing excellent service, which is vital in the estate agency sector.
✨Prepare for Role-Play Scenarios
Expect to engage in role-play during the interview, simulating property viewings or negotiations. Practising these scenarios beforehand can help you feel more confident and showcase your communication skills effectively.
✨Demonstrate Organisational Skills
Being organised is essential for managing multiple property listings and client appointments. Share examples of how you've successfully managed your time and tasks in previous roles, highlighting your ability to stay detail-oriented under pressure.
